This is the true story of a love affair that began online in June 2007. He was in Kathmandu, an ex-Irish Army officer working for the UN and she was in Cork working as a supply teacher. It is set against the background of the Nepalese elections of 2008 and the Sudan elections of 2010 when South Sudan became a separate country.
After her adventurous journey to Kathmandu to meet Patrick, Liz finds the long-distance separation and lack of communication difficult. The worst part is that she is powerless to do anything about it. She copes with the loneliness by revisiting her once favourite occupation as a flaneuse. We stroll with her as she explores Budapest, Berlin and Hanoi. We get a taste of Rome, Bilbao and Shanghai.
The people who enter her world: her lover, friends, colleagues and strangers are candidly and sometimes bluntly portrayed which makes them as vulnerable and exposed as she is.
